Just to let others know if they have the same problem.


It seems i should have been looking for a "O2 Xphone II KEYPAD RIBBON"

Ebay US has one.

T5 Screw driver.


Im waiting for mine thats coming from Hong Kong.....  $15USD  +  Postage     I just cant imagine it any cheaper.  Love it when that happens!!
